WebApr 12, 2024 · Beyond the control colors, the Army-issued M17s have several differences from the civilian-sale P320s and M17 commemorative editions. Specifically, the Army guns have: – Heavier slides. – Heavier recoil springs (they are intended for a long service life of all +P ammunition) – Two extra recoil lug holes in the red dot mounting plate.
